Psychological & emotional meaning

From a Freudian perspective, breaking a phone in a dream could signify repressed feelings about communication. The phone may represent a desire to connect, while its breaking can indicate frustration or fear of being misunderstood. Jung might interpret this symbol as a call to examine one's journey and relationships, suggesting that the road signifies life's path and the phone symbolizes the means of sharing one's thoughts and feelings. Together, they may reflect an internal conflict regarding how you communicate and whether you feel heard or valued in your relationships.

Physical & scientific causes

During sleep, our brain processes various stimuli, and dreams often reflect our daily experiences and emotions. A phone represents communication, while a road can symbolize a journey in life. Dreaming about breaking a phone may often occur during times of heightened stress or anxiety, suggesting that the mind is grappling with feelings of inadequacy in connecting with others. This dream may also result from disrupted sleep patterns, where external noises or interruptions influence the subconscious mind, leading to vivid imagery regarding relationships and personal pathways.
